Preparing Your Home to Sell

Image
Whether you're downsizing, a soon-to-be empty nester, or relocating to another state, the task of selling your house can be challenging.  Although it’s a huge undertaking,  strategic and pro-active planning can help speed the process. Here are some tips to help navigate your house selling approach.    Detach.   Take your personality out of the house. While this can be painful, the sooner you decide on it the better,  giving the potential buyer an opportunity to let in their personality.     Curb Appeal.  Landscaping is the foundation to making a good impression.  You will need to mow the lawn, prune bushes, and weed. Spruce up the front with some potted plants. Prospective buyers need to have an uncluttered view of your lawn before they enter your house.     Clean up the Outside.
